From all the results of these present studies, the authors offer the following conclusions. There is a good correlation between weight loss after elevated temperature aging and the coating's inherent property of Tg, as determined by DMA maximum tan δ-although it would appear that DMA Tg is a more sensitive indicator of thermal aging change.
